Trading courses can help you learn technical analysis, risk management, market psychology, and trading strategies. You can build skills in chart reading, identifying trends, and executing trades effectively. Many courses introduce tools like trading platforms, financial modeling software, and data analysis tools to help you apply these skills in real market situations. You’ll also explore key topics such as options trading, forex markets, and cryptocurrency, allowing you to develop a well-rounded understanding of various trading environments.
